For anyone who may find this in the future...

The TB on an '04 GTO (LS1) is the same TB that's on a '00 - '02 Firebird/Camaro (LS1). The "Drive by Wire" TBs on the GTO showed up on the LS2.

So, I guess the guy was right that his TB will fit my '00 WS6.
